When we think of "popular entertainment studios," legacy often leads the conversation. These are the giants that have transitioned from the Golden Age of Hollywood into the digital era without losing their grip on the global box office. The Walt Disney Company

Disney is arguably the most dominant force in entertainment today. Beyond its own storied animation studio, Disney’s strategic acquisitions have turned it into an unstoppable conglomerate. By bringing Marvel Studios, Lucasfilm, and Pixar under its umbrella, Disney controls the most lucrative intellectual properties (IP) in history—from the Avengers and Star Wars to Toy Story. Warner Bros. Discovery

Home to the DC Extended Universe (DCEU), the Wizarding World of Harry Potter, and the legendary HBO brand, Warner Bros. remains a pillar of high-quality storytelling. Their production style often leans into darker, more complex narratives compared to Disney’s family-centric model, catering to a vast adult demographic through HBO/Max Originals. Universal Pictures

Universal has mastered the art of the "franchise." With the Fast & Furious saga, Jurassic World, and the world-dominating animation of Illumination (Despicable Me, The Super Mario Bros. Movie), Universal consistently proves that high-octane action and vibrant family fun are the keys to global appeal. The Disruption of Streaming Productions

The landscape of modern entertainment is dominated by a few "titans" that manage everything from blockbuster movies to global streaming platforms. Today, the industry is led by the "Big Five" major film studios, which distribute hundreds of films annually to international markets. The Big Five Studios

These studios are the engines behind most of the culture-defining productions we see today:

Walt Disney Studios: Known for its massive umbrella of brands, including Marvel Studios (Avengers), Lucasfilm (Star Wars), and Pixar. It is a cornerstone of The Walt Disney Company, which remains one of the world's largest entertainment entities.

Warner Bros. Pictures: A historic studio responsible for the DC Universe, the Harry Potter franchise (Wizarding World), and recent hits like Barbie.

Universal Pictures: Owned by Comcast, Universal is famous for the Jurassic Park, Fast & Furious, and Despicable Me franchises.

Sony Pictures: A division of the Sony Group, this studio manages the Spider-Man cinematic universe (in partnership with Marvel) and various PlayStation-based adaptations.

Paramount Pictures: The studio behind legendary productions like Mission: Impossible, Top Gun, and the Star Trek series. The Rise of Digital "Studios"

While the traditional "Big Five" lead in theatrical releases, tech-driven production houses have changed how we consume entertainment:

Netflix Studios: They pioneered the "binge-watch" model with original productions like Stranger Things, Squid Game, and Bridgerton.

A24: A "boutique" studio that has gained massive popularity for its unique, creator-driven films like Everything Everywhere All At Once and Hereditary.

Amazon MGM Studios: Following Amazon’s acquisition of the historic MGM, they now control the James Bond franchise and produce high-budget series like The Lord of the Rings: The Rings of Power. Notable Independent & Specialized Productions

Legendary Entertainment: Often partners with major studios for "spectacle" films like Dune and the MonsterVerse (Godzilla vs. Kong).

Blumhouse Productions: A powerhouse in the horror genre, known for high-profit, low-budget hits like Get Out and M3GAN. If you'd like to dive deeper, let me know:
